The Coyote Mountains Wilderness encompasses a significant expanse of rugged desert terrain in Imperial County, California. Characterized by steep, rocky mountains, winding canyons, and sparse desert vegetation, the environment here is both challenging and breathtaking. Unlike traditional campgrounds with manicured sites and amenities, the wilderness area emphasizes self-sufficiency and leaving no trace. For local users accustomed to more developed camping options, the Coyote Mountains Wilderness presents a chance to experience the desert in its natural state, demanding respect for its delicate ecosystem and requiring careful planning and preparation.

Given its wilderness designation, detailed information about specific services and features akin to a developed campground is inherently limited. Wilderness areas are managed to preserve their natural character, which typically means the absence of constructed facilities such as restrooms, picnic tables, designated campsites, or water sources. Campers venturing into the Coyote Mountains Wilderness should be entirely self-reliant, carrying all necessary supplies, including water, food, shelter, navigation tools, and waste disposal bags. The focus here is on primitive camping, where the land itself dictates your campsite and your preparedness ensures your safety and comfort.

The primary feature of the Coyote Mountains Wilderness is its untamed and remote environment. This offers a unique appeal to those seeking solitude, challenging hikes, and the opportunity to experience the desert's natural beauty firsthand. The rugged terrain provides opportunities for hiking and exploration, with the potential to encounter native desert flora and fauna. The vastness of the wilderness also offers exceptional stargazing opportunities, far from the light pollution of urban areas. For local users interested in photography, nature observation, or simply immersing themselves in a wild landscape, the Coyote Mountains Wilderness provides a compelling destination.

It is important to emphasize that camping in a wilderness area like the Coyote Mountains requires a high degree of responsibility and adherence to Leave No Trace principles. This includes packing out all trash, minimizing campfire impacts (or using a camp stove), respecting wildlife, leaving natural objects undisturbed, and being considerate of other visitors. Additionally, navigating in a wilderness area requires skill in map and compass use or GPS, as trails may be faint or unmarked. Campers should also be aware of potential desert hazards such as extreme temperatures, venomous animals, and the need for adequate hydration.
